Skip to content

Commit b89974d

Browse files
authored
[NFC] Cleanup includes in lib/TritonIntelGPUTransforms (#3694)
Signed-off-by: Anatoly Myachev <[email protected]>
1 parent 824170b commit b89974d

File tree

6 files changed

+0
-23
lines changed

6 files changed

+0
-23
lines changed

third_party/intel/lib/TritonIntelGPUTransforms/AccelerateMatmul.cpp

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,6 @@
1414
#include "triton/Dialect/Triton/IR/Dialect.h"
1515
#include "triton/Dialect/Triton/IR/Utility.h"
1616
#include "triton/Dialect/TritonGPU/IR/Dialect.h"
17-
#include "triton/Tools/Sys/GetEnv.hpp"
1817
#include "llvm/ADT/TypeSwitch.h"
1918
#include <optional>
2019

third_party/intel/lib/TritonIntelGPUTransforms/DecomposeScaledBlocked.cpp

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,6 @@
33
#include "mlir/IR/Types.h"
44
#include "mlir/IR/Value.h"
55
#include "mlir/Support/LogicalResult.h"
6-
#include "mlir/Transforms/GreedyPatternRewriteDriver.h"
76

87
#include "triton/Dialect/Triton/IR/Dialect.h"
98
#include "triton/Dialect/TritonGPU/IR/Attributes.h"

third_party/intel/lib/TritonIntelGPUTransforms/Pipeliner/SoftwarePipeliner.cpp

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,12 +1,10 @@
1-
21
#include "mlir/IR/TypeUtilities.h"
32
#include "mlir/Interfaces/LoopLikeInterface.h"
43

54
#include "Pipeliner/Schedule.h"
65

76
#include "intel/include/Dialect/TritonIntelGPU/IR/Dialect.h"
87
#include "intel/include/Dialect/TritonIntelGPU/Transforms/Passes.h"
9-
#include "intel/include/Dialect/TritonIntelGPU/Transforms/Utility.h"
108

119
using namespace mlir;
1210
namespace ttgi = mlir::triton::gpu::intel;

third_party/intel/lib/TritonIntelGPUTransforms/PrefetchBlock.cpp

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-44,7 +44,6 @@
4444
#include "mlir/IR/BuiltinAttributes.h"
4545
#include "mlir/IR/PatternMatch.h"
4646

47-
#include "intel/include/Dialect/TritonGEN/IR/TritonGENDialect.h"
4847
#include "intel/include/Dialect/TritonIntelGPU/IR/Dialect.h"
4948
#include "intel/include/Dialect/TritonIntelGPU/Transforms/Passes.h"
5049

third_party/intel/lib/TritonIntelGPUTransforms/ReduceDataDuplication.cpp

Lines changed: 0 additions &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-1,30 +1,16 @@
11
#include "intel/include/Dialect/TritonIntelGPU/IR/Dialect.h"
22
#include "mlir/Analysis/SliceAnalysis.h"
3-
#include "mlir/Dialect/SCF/IR/SCF.h"
43
#include "mlir/IR/BuiltinAttributes.h"
5-
#include "mlir/IR/IRMapping.h"
6-
#include "mlir/IR/Matchers.h"
7-
#include "mlir/IR/PatternMatch.h"
8-
#include "mlir/IR/Verifier.h"
9-
#include "mlir/Interfaces/InferTypeOpInterface.h"
10-
#include "mlir/Pass/Pass.h"
11-
#include "mlir/Pass/PassManager.h"
124
#include "mlir/Support/LLVM.h"
13-
#include "mlir/Support/LogicalResult.h"
14-
#include "mlir/Transforms/GreedyPatternRewriteDriver.h"
15-
#include "mlir/Transforms/Passes.h"
16-
#include "mlir/Transforms/RegionUtils.h"
175
#include "triton/Analysis/Utility.h"
186
#include "triton/Dialect/TritonGPU/IR/Dialect.h"
197
#include "triton/Dialect/TritonGPU/Transforms/Passes.h"
20-
#include "triton/Dialect/TritonGPU/Transforms/TritonGPUConversion.h"
218

229
namespace mlir::triton::gpu::intel {
2310
#define GEN_PASS_DEF_TRITONINTELGPUREDUCEDATADUPLICATION
2411
#include "intel/include/Dialect/TritonIntelGPU/Transforms/Passes.h.inc"
2512
} // namespace mlir::triton::gpu::intel
2613

27-
namespace ttgi = mlir::triton::gpu::intel;
2814
using namespace mlir;
2915
using namespace mlir::triton;
3016
using namespace mlir::triton::gpu;

third_party/intel/lib/TritonIntelGPUTransforms/RewriteStackPtr.cpp

Lines changed: 0 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-5,12 +5,8 @@
55
#include "mlir/Interfaces/FunctionInterfaces.h"
66
#include "triton/Analysis/Allocation.h"
77
#include "triton/Conversion/TritonGPUToLLVM/Utility.h"
8-
#include "llvm/Support/raw_ostream.h"
98

109
using namespace mlir;
11-
namespace tt = mlir::triton;
12-
namespace ttg = mlir::triton::gpu;
13-
namespace ttgi = mlir::triton::gpu::intel;
1410

1511
namespace mlir::triton::gpu::intel {
1612
#define GEN_PASS_DEF_TRITONINTELGPUREWRITESTACKPTR

0 commit comments

Comments
 (0)